At MLC we had a council about weather or not the Sister Training Leaders should attend DLC (Dictrict Leader Council) and it was decided that we would! It's a meeting where all of the DLs from the Zone get together with the ZLs and discuss what was discussed at MLC and then decide how they will present that to the Zone.
